Issues with the game? Check the Known Issues list before reporting! Dismiss Notice WebUnit Converter. Multiply the rate of meters per second by 2.2369. Example: 30 meters per second times 2.2369 equals 67.107, so 30 meters per second equals 67.107 miles per hour. Check your work by dividing your result by 2.2369. If you arrive at your original rate of meters per second then you have properly done your work.

Click clear to clear the value and convert another value. m/s = 16.6667 / min/km. m/s = km/h * 0.2778. m/s = 26.8224 / min/mi. m/s = mph * 0.44704. m/s is then converted to result units using following conversions: WebValue in m/s = value in mph × 0.44704. Suppose you want to convert 30 mph into m/s. Using the conversion formula above, you will get: Value in m/s = 30 × 0.44704 = 13.4112 m/s.
